How To Repair Relationships & Create Lasting Emotional Connection https://offer.personaldevelopmentschool.com/relationship-repair?utm_source=podcast&utm_campaign=relationship-repair&utm_medium=organic&utm_content=pod-04-15-26&el=podcast Many people believe childhood trauma only refers to extreme experiences. But in reality, trauma can also come from repeated emotional experiences that shaped the way we see ourselves, others, and relationships. These experiences can deeply influence how we attach to people, how safe we feel in relationships, and how we respond to closeness, distance, and conflict in our love lives. Childhood trauma doesn't always look obvious. Sometimes it comes from painful experiences, and other times it comes from important emotional needs that were never fully met growing up. Episode Summary In this episode, Thais Gibson explains what trauma really is, how it forms in childhood, and how different attachment styles develop as protective strategies that shape the way we show up in adult relationships. Send us Fan Mail In this episode, we take a closer look at Double Fantasy, the 1980 album that marked John Lennon's long-awaited return to recording. Blending songs from both John Lennon and Yoko Ono, the album captures themes of love, family, adulthood, and starting over, all wrapped in a deeply personal and often emotional sound. We talk about the stories behind the songs, the album's original reception, and how its meaning changed in the wake of Lennon's death just weeks after its release. Join us as we explore Double Fantasy as both a comeback record and a lasting final chapter in one of music's most unforgettable careers. Send us a text & leave your email address if you want a reply!You fell madly in love. The sex was electric. Then life happened; kids, careers, cortisol, and somewhere along the way, one of you stopped wanting it as much as the other. If mismatched libidos are quietly creating distance in your relationship, you are not broken and neither is your partner. Research suggests that up to 80% of couples will experience some form of desire discrepancy at some point in their relationship and it is one of the most common reasons couples seek help. But there is a road back and it is more accessible than you think. In this honest, deeply practical episode, hosts Leah Piper and Dr. Willow Brown go deep on why long-term relationships lose their erotic charge and exactly what to do to rebuild it.EPISODE HIGHLIGHTSThe behaviors that made desire feel effortless in early courtship were actively feeding responsive desire. Rebuild those behaviors and you rebuild the libido.Stress and cortisol are among the most underacknowledged drivers of low sex drive in long-term relationships. Addressing what is creating pressure in your daily life is sexual health work.You can take responsibility for your own turn-on rather than waiting for a partner to guess their way to it.Short Tantric practices do not require a full intimacy session. Even five minutes of breath and eye contact can meaningfully shift the dynamic between partners.Knowing what you want erotically, your accelerators, is at least as important as knowing what you do not want.LINKS & RESOURCES MENTIONED IN THE EPISODE CAN BE FOUND ON THE WEBSITE: https://www.sexreimagined.com/blog/mismatched-libido-long-term-relationshipsPOWER OF PLEASURE | Join our FREE Live Online Summit - April 28-29, 2026 featuring 12 leading intimacy experts in conscious sexuality, desire and erotic healing.
